NYC Collection Boxes in the Area Receive Temporary Seal / Removal
NEW YORK – In the interest of safety and security, postal officials will temporarily seal or remove Postal Service collection boxes on Saturday, April 26, in New York City.
The familiar blue collection boxes will be inaccessible until reopened on Monday, April 28.
